Electronic Arts, the world’s largest interactive entertainment software company, announced it has completed its previously announced acquisition of Westwood Studios, and the Irvine, Calif.-based Virgin Studio from Virgin Interactive Entertainment Inc., a division of Spelling Entertainment Group Inc. The cash transaction is valued at $122.5 million.
